Glossary


v MOU: Memorandum of understanding between two or more nations which further strengthen the policies economic cultural or other relations.

 

v NWFP: Federally administered province in India during British rule.

 

v Diplomacy: It is an Institution or concept which enthuse relations among nation.

 

v WTO: World Trade Organization is a trade organization to formulate economic and trade policies between the nations of the world.


v SAARC: South Asian Association for Regional Cooperation is a regional organization for strengthening cooperation among the countries in South Asia.

 

v Trust Deficit: it is the diplomatic factor concerned with the strained relations between Nations.

 

v NAM: Non-Aligned Movement is an organization established by third world countries to keep themselves neutral.

 

v SPDC: State Peace and Development Council is an official name of Military Government of Burma.

 

v Bretton Woods System: It established the rules for commercial and financial relations among the world.

 

v Super Power: Super power countries are economically and militarily advanced.
